This study aimed to validate a Religious Collective Self-Esteem Scale (RCSES) that assesses children's evaluations and judgments about their belonging to a religious group. The RCSES includes 3 subscales: Private Religious Self-Esteem (PrRSE), Public Religious Self-Esteem (PURSE), and Importance to Religious Identity (RI). Data were gathered from students in 39 primary schools (9 Reformed Protestant. 9 Islamic, 3 Hindu and 18 public schools) across five regions in the Netherlands. Students were asked to complete an anonymous questionnaire containing measures of variables of interest. Subjects were 1,437 6th graders (M-age = 11.72, SD = 0.61; 51.7% girls. 680 Students identified themselves as Muslim (47.3%), 442 (30.8%) as Christian, 278 (19.3%) as Hindu, and 37 (2.6%) children had another religion. Results indicated sufficient internal consistency of RCSES (alpha = .80), PrRSE (alpha = .77), PuRSE (alpha = .73), and RI (alpha = .60), moderate to high correlations between the subscales and moderate to large test-retest reliability across 1 year (r = .57). Three-factor model fitted the best. Overall, findings sup t partial measurement and structural invariance across religious groups. Convergent validity was supported by small to moderate correlations with other scales (Individual Self-Esteem Scale, r = .29; Private Ethnic Self-Esteem Scale (PESES), r = .40). Divergent validity was supported by positive small significant correlations with school well-being (r = .18) and social school motivation (r = .19). RCSES and its subscales significantly predicted, over and above PESES, school well-being and school motivation scores. Findings support the reliability and validity of the RCSES for assessing religious collective self-esteem.
